homescreen-2017 does not have systemd unit

Description

With the above build of agl-demo-platform, no homescreen is ever launched. Tested on both qemux86-64 and intel-corei7-64

Environment

Eel as of 4.99.1, adding agl-hmi-framework to DISTRO_FEATURES list, agl-demo-platform image.

Activity

Walt Miner 
November 3, 2017 at 10:19 PM

Closing as part of EE RC2

Romain Forlot 
October 30, 2017 at 3:49 PM

Attached gerrit review fix homescreen autostart issue

Romain Forlot 
October 18, 2017 at 10:34 AM

Unit file are correctly created at installation, we have two unit:

But where is the issue is that appli unit file doesn't have an [Install] section with default.target in it and so can't be enabled.

So, homescreen widget need to set this permission to be able to be loaded at start by default :

#required-permission.urn:AGL:permission::system:run-by-default

Fixed

Details

Assignee

Reporter

Fix versions

Labels

Contract ID

Components

Affects versions

Priority

Created October 17, 2017 at 1:17 PM
Updated November 3, 2017 at 10:19 PM
Resolved October 30, 2017 at 3:49 PM